Prepare your account for Warframe Platinum trading

Before looking for a buyer, make sure your account can trade. Digital Extremes states that PC and Cross Platform Save players need TennoGuard 2FA to trade in-game items. Cross Platform Play also needs to be enabled for trades with other platforms.

Check these settings outside a mission. If you play on Nintendo Switch, remember the official limitation: Platinum trading with other platforms does not work like other cross-platform trades.

  1. Enable TennoGuard 2FA if your account requires it.
  2. Turn on Cross Platform Play.
  3. Join a Clan Dojo with a trading post or use Maroo's Bazaar.
  4. Prepare the item before inviting the buyer.
  5. Read the final amount before accepting.

Best items to sell first for Platinum

The common beginner mistake is selling anything that looks rare. Keep anything that unlocks a weapon, Warframe or mod you plan to use. Then sell duplicates.

Prime Parts are the easiest starting point. Relics naturally create duplicates while you play Void Fissures. Complete sets are often easier to sell than loose pieces.

ItemSell early?Practical rule
Duplicate Prime PartYesSell it if you already own or do not want the set.
Complete Prime SetYesBundle pieces together for an easier sale.
Useful rare modCarefullyAlways keep one copy for builds.
Syndicate or Baro weaponOnly unusedEven 1 XP can make it untradeable.
Starting PlatinumNoStarting Platinum is not tradeable.

Set fair Platinum prices without wasting time

Warframe does not set one permanent price for every item. Demand changes with Prime rotations, player supply and current interest. Compare several active offers, choose a realistic number, then lower it slightly for a fast sale.

  • Fast sale: price slightly below common listings.
  • Normal sale: match current active offers.
  • Patient sale: price higher only on demanded rare pieces.

Trade safely in a Dojo or Maroo's Bazaar

The safest rule is simple: everything must appear inside the in-game trade window. Ignore external promises, code offers, doubled Platinum claims and pressure to trust a stranger.

  1. Confirm the buyer's name.
  2. Add only the agreed item.
  3. Check the Platinum amount.
  4. Wait until both offers stop changing.
  5. Cancel if the other player changes anything without explanation.

Spend your first Platinum on the best upgrades

Once you earn your first Platinum, avoid spending it immediately on cosmetics. Warframe rewards building, leveling and testing many items. Slots are the best early investment.

  1. Buy Warframe slots when crafting a new frame.
  2. Buy weapon slots to keep leveling gear for Mastery Rank.
  3. Add companion slots when builds expand.
  4. Save cosmetics for later.

Avoid these early Platinum trading mistakes

Do not sell your only copy of an important mod. Do not spend Platinum on something you can easily farm. Do not accept trades outside the official system.

Keep a simple list of duplicate Prime Parts, extra mods and unused Syndicate items. Sell only what you can replace.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I enable cross-platform trading in Warframe?

Enable Cross Platform Play and check the official Cross Platform Progression guide.

Why can't I trade my starting Platinum?

Warframe Support states that the starting 50 Platinum and some promotional Platinum cannot be traded.

Where should I trade safely?

Use the in-game trade window in a Clan Dojo or at Maroo's Bazaar.

What should beginners sell first?

Start with duplicate Prime Parts, complete sets and duplicate rare mods while keeping one copy for builds.

Can I sell a Syndicate weapon after using it once?

No. Special Syndicate or Baro weapons must remain unused to be tradeable.

What if the buyer changes the Platinum amount?

Cancel the trade and ask for a clean offer. Never accept a changed trade without agreement.

What should I buy with my first Platinum?

Buy Warframe, weapon and companion slots before cosmetics.
